Abstract


The objective of the present work is to study the effect of neem and palm oil biodiesel on the performance of the diesel engine. Different parameter testings and result formulations can be performed to enhance the different properties of additives poured in the diesel fuel. In the quest for renewable energy resource, efforts are made to find out options to alternative fuels. Blending of different vegetable based fuels has become a necessity and is gaining the attention of many researchers because the properties of the biodiesel prepared from vegetable oils are very close to those of diesel. In this work, the performance of the diesel engine is evaluated using hybrid biodiesel i.e. neem and palm oil biodiesel used as fuel. A comparative performance study gives the best blend for the diesel engine. The results show that engine performance, when fueled with biodiesel, has the same result that can be compared to petroleum fuel. B20 is found to be the best blend as it has the highest brake power and volumetric efficiency as well as higher break thermal efficiency and less emissions, compared to the other blends. Biodiesel is a good substitute for diesel and it is also more convenient over diesel for environmental reasons.In this review paper, an attempt is made to overview the research work done so far on non edible oil obtained from various blends and its performance in Diesel Engines. Biodiesel generally produces lower HC, CO and PM emissions compared to diesel. The cetane improver, which gives better Combustion characteristics, reduces the ignition delay and the maximum amount of fuel burnt nearer the TDC and no fuel remains for the after combustion stage or exhaust pipe combustion. Lower heating values give less heat generation, which causes lower exhaust gas temperature.
